We specialize in overhaul and repair of aircraft components for the military and commercial aircraft. We pride ourselves in offering a work environment that is more than just a job where employees are respected, able to grow, and be proud to be a part of.
Job Summary:
This is a full-time on-site role for a Production Manager, based in Del City, OK. The Production Manager will oversee daily operations of the production department including repair and manufacturing, ensuring schedules are met and quality standards are upheld. Responsibilities include workflow management, team supervision, performance evaluation, inventory control, and implementing process improvements. The manager will also ensure workplace safety, compliance with industry regulations, and collaboration with other departments to meet organizational goals.Duties/Responsibilities:
Collaborates with other managers and supervisors to coordinate activities in and among departments. Collects, evaluates, analyzes, and assesses production data. Maintains due dates and runs production based on KPI's. Regularly inspects and evaluates products for quality and defects. Identifies and corrects problems and inefficiencies in process, materials, equipment, or skills. Develops and implements procedures and strategies to ensure a safe work environment.
